Run Payments Launches Run Merchant: One Platform for Total Control

 In today’s fast-paced digital economy, businesses need more than just payment processing they need clarity, speed, and control. That’s exactly what Run Payments delivers with the launch of Run Merchant, a powerful platform that unifies payments, reporting, and dispute management into a single, orchestrated system.

Simplifying the Complexities of Payments

Managing transactions across multiple providers can quickly become overwhelming. From reconciling reports to chasing down disputes, many businesses find themselves spending more time untangling payment issues than focusing on growth. Run Merchant is built to change that. By consolidating these critical processes into one platform, it eliminates unnecessary complexity and streamlines the payment journey.

Real-Time Insights for Smarter Decisions

With Run Merchant, businesses gain real-time visibility into every transaction. Instead of waiting for end-of-day reports or juggling spreadsheets, teams can act instantly—tracking performance, spotting issues, and resolving disputes before they escalate. This level of visibility empowers organizations to operate more efficiently and respond faster to challenges.

Designed for Growth

"Run Merchant is about making payments simple again,” said Rob Nathan, Co-Founder and CEO of Run Payments. “By bringing everything into one orchestrated view, businesses can act faster, resolve issues in real time, and focus on growth rather than payment complexities.”

Whether you’re a small business scaling quickly or a large enterprise handling massive transaction volumes, Run Merchant adapts to your needs. Its flexible design ensures that as your business grows, your payment processes grow with you without adding new layers of complexity.

The Future of Payments Management

The launch of Run Merchant marks a step forward for businesses seeking total control over their payment operations. By blending simplicity, speed, and scalability, Run Payments is helping companies not only streamline their financial workflows but also unlock new opportunities for innovation and customer satisfaction.

With Run Merchant, the future of payments looks more connected, more transparent, and far less complicated.

Tokenized Trading: How Blockchain Is Revolutionizing Asset Markets

 In recent years, the rise of blockchain technology has transformed everything from payments to logistics. But one of its most groundbreaking applications lies in the world of tokenized trading — where real-world and digital assets are converted into blockchain-based tokens that can be bought, sold, or traded just like traditional securities. What Is Tokenized Trading? Tokenized trading refers to the conversion of real-world assets (like stocks, bonds, real estate, or commodities) into digital tokens on a blockchain. These tokens represent ownership and can be fractionalized, making previously illiquid or expensive assets more accessible. Imagine owning a fraction of a luxury apartment in Manhattan or a piece of fine art by simply buying a token. That’s the power of tokenization — it democratizes access and opens up new possibilities for investors and institutions alike .
